Opis
In a universe steeped in tension and prejudice, the Sackers stand out as a reviled race, universally scorned for their grotesque appearance and notorious history. As the narrative unfolds, the story delves into the complexities of alien interactions, exposing the deep-seated biases that govern intergalactic relationships. The Sackers, often judged for their physical traits, navigate a hostile landscape where any semblance of understanding seems out of reach.
Amidst this backdrop of animosity, an unexpected protagonist emerges from the shadows of hatred. As the tale weaves through the lives of both Sackers and their adversaries, themes of identity, redemption, and the fight for acceptance take center stage. The characters confront the stark realities of their existence, forcing them to reconsider long-held beliefs and wrestle with their own prejudices.
As tensions escalate, the stakes grow ever higher. The narrative captivates with its exploration of societal norms and the possibility of change, challenging readers to reflect on their understanding of compassion and coexistence. With each passing moment, the fate of the universe hangs in the balance, making for a story that is as thought-provoking as it is thrilling.
